Affected Products
026-20036A Liberty Drain Line, Luer Tap For patients with acute and chronic end stage renal disease going under PD in healthcare or home setting
Quantity: 6 Cases
Why Was This Recalled?
Exposed to freezing temperatures due to refrigerated truck malfunctions
Where Was This Sold?
This product was distributed to 1 state: TX
